Significant differences between Oregano and Coriander seeds
- Oregano has more Iron, Manganese, Calcium, Folate, and Vitamin B2, however, Coriander seeds are richer in Selenium, Copper, Phosphorus, Vitamin C, and Zinc.
- Oregano covers your daily Iron needs 256% more than Coriander seeds.
Specific food types used in this comparison are Spices, oregano, dried and Spices, coriander seed.

Comparison summary
Which food contains less Sodium?
Oregano contains less Sodium (difference - 10mg)
Which food is richer in vitamins?
Oregano is relatively richer in vitamins
Which food is lower in Sugar?
Coriander seeds is lower in Sugar (difference - 4.09g)
Which food is lower in Saturated Fat?
Coriander seeds is lower in Saturated Fat (difference - 0.561g)
Which food is lower in glycemic index?
Coriander seeds is lower in glycemic index (difference - 5)
Which food is cheaper?
Coriander seeds is cheaper (difference - $4.6)
Which food is richer in minerals?
Coriander seeds is relatively richer in minerals
Which food contains less Cholesterol?
?
The foods are relatively equal in Cholesterol (0 mg)
